Claims
- 1. A method for coding two coefficients comprising:a) transforming the two coefficients into two pairs of random variables, one random variable in each pair having substantially equal energy as one random variable in the other pair; b) quantizing each of the pairs of random variables; and c) entropy coding each quantized random variable separately.
- 2. The method according to claim 1, further comprising pairing said entropy coded random variables for transmission over a plurality of channels.

- 11. A method for performing multiple description coding on a block of coefficients, comprising the steps of:a) pairing coefficients within the block of coefficients to form a plurality of coefficient pairs; b) transforming each coefficient pair into a first pair of transformed coefficients and a second pair of transformed coefficients; c) quantizing each of the first and second pair of transformed coefficients; and d) assigning the first and second pair of quantized and transformed coefficients to different channels.
- 12. The method according to claim 11, further comprising the step of:e) entropy encoding each member of the first pair of quantized and transformed coefficients and each member of the second pair of quantized and transformed coefficients separately prior to transmission.

- 14. The method according to claim 11, wherein the transforming step further comprises transforming each coefficient pair into the first and second transformed coefficients using a unitary transform such that the first and second transformed coefficients have substantially equivalent energy.
